Emma was published at the end of 1815, with 2,000 copies being printed563, more than a quarter, were still unsold after four years.

Occasionally the text of a book will be put into a specialized book press and painted, often with a scene from the book or a landscape, so that the painting is invisible when the book is closed but visible when somebody bends the text and fans the pagesknown as a foreedge painting. Talking book topics is published bimonthly in audio, largeprint, and online formats and distributed at no cost to participants in the library of congress reading program for people who are blind or have a physical disability.
